The recently completed Marine Business Park in the North Quay area of Hayle in Cornwall, England, will be officially opened on February 12.

The business park has quayside access to the sea, with plans for a new slipway in the future. There is also expansion land for a further 800m² of buildings.

The project is dedicated to businesses in the marine renewables and marine technology sectors, which can lease space in the new Business Park.

The project has been led by Cornwall Council with the support of Cornwall Development Company, which secured European Convergence funding to deliver the first phase of the Marine Business Park, with match funding provided by the Department for Business, Innovation and Skills (BIS), the Department of Energy and Climate Change (DECC) and the Council.

The new business park has been delivered as part of a major economic development initiative which has delivered Wave Hub – the grid connected ‘plug’ for testing wave energy devices which lies seven miles of the coast of Hayle.

“The opening of the HMRBP marks an important step in the development of the Marine renewable sector in Cornwall. I am delighted that Hayle continues to play such a prominent role in this industry and this facility enhances future employment potential based on the Wave Hub offshore,” local media quotes John Pollard , councillor for Hayle North and leader of Cornwall Council, as saying.
